Using with Panasonic PBX:

Connecting to a PBX allows you to answer calls from the door station using additional machines (extensions).

Please use only a Panasonic PBX (page 4).

Note:

If you answer a call from the door station with a PBX extension, the camera image taken by the door station will be displayed at the main

monitor station. will appear in the top of the display indicating that a PBX extension is on the call (see C on page 11). While is displayed, you cannot answer the call using the main monitor station. The display will turn off when the conversation between the door station and the PBX extension ends, or if the call duration time is longer than 3 minutes.

If you answer a call from the door station with the main monitor station or the sub monitor station, the call will continue to ring at the extension for about 15 to 30 seconds. Even if an extension user wants to answer the call while the call is ringing, the extension user cannot participate in the call.

When using two door stations

(excluding an optional lobby station, page 4):

From the PBX extension, you can call up the only one door station that has received the last incoming call or has talked with.
